Therapeutic approaches and online care that fit your life

Roberta commonly uses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, which helps people clarify what matters to them and take small actions that match those values even when emotions are hard. This approach is useful for anxiety, depression, and decisions about life changes.

She also uses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, which looks at the connection between thoughts, feelings, and behavior and teaches practical exercises to change patterns that maintain distress. CBT is often helpful for sleep problems, anxiety, ADHD-related struggles, and mood regulation.

Finding the right approach is a collaborative process. Roberta will talk with each person about their goals, try methods that fit those goals, and adjust the plan based on what helps. Clients are invited to give feedback so therapy stays practical and relevant.

Online formats include video calls, phone sessions, live chat, and text-based messaging. Video is good for more in-depth work and real-time interaction, phone can be easier when bandwidth is limited, live chat works for quick check-ins, and messaging lets people share updates between sessions. These options make it easier to fit therapy into a busy schedule and to use the format that feels most comfortable.
